Satu Valo is a scholar working on Pathology and Forensic Medicine, Molecular Biology and Cancer Research. According to data from OpenAlex, Satu Valo has authored 12 papers receiving a total of 315 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Pathology and Forensic Medicine, 5 papers in Molecular Biology and 4 papers in Cancer Research. Recurrent topics in Satu Valo's work include Genetic factors in colorectal cancer (8 papers), RNA modifications and cancer (3 papers) and Cancer Genomics and Diagnostics (3 papers). Satu Valo is often cited by papers focused on Genetic factors in colorectal cancer (8 papers), RNA modifications and cancer (3 papers) and Cancer Genomics and Diagnostics (3 papers). Satu Valo collaborates with scholars based in Finland, United Arab Emirates and United States. Satu Valo's co-authors include Païvi Peltomäki, Wael M. Abdel‐Rahman, Jukka‐Pekka Mecklin, Minna Nyström, Heikki Järvinen, Taina T. Nieminen, Hannes Lohi, Yunpeng Wu, Pierre‐Emmanuel Gleizes and Marie-Françoise O’Donohue and has published in prestigious journals such as SHILAP Revista de lepidopterología, Gastroenterology and PLoS ONE.
